Wash. Admin. Code § 296-52-67075 - Blast area precautions
(1)
Warning signs. Blast area warning signs must:
(a) Be set up at all entrances to the blast
area.
(b) Have lettering a minimum
of four inches high and on a contrasting background.
(2)
Loaded stumps. All loaded
stumps must be marked for identification.
(3)
Lock out. Cables close to
the blast area must be deenergized and locked out by the blaster in
charge.
